Buying Guide for the Best Compression Socks For Pregnant Women

Compression socks can be a great help for pregnant women, as they can alleviate swelling, improve circulation, and reduce the risk of varicose veins. When choosing the right pair of compression socks,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ure they meet your needs and provide the desired benefits. Here are the key specs to look out for and how to choose the best fit for you.
Compression LevelCompression level refers to the amount of pressure the socks apply to your legs, measured in millimeters of mercury (mmHg). This is important because the right level of compression can help improve blood flow and reduce swelling. Compression levels are typically divided into light (8-15 mmHg), moderate (15-20 mmHg), firm (20-30 mmHg), and extra firm (30-40 mmHg). For pregnant women, moderate compression (15-20 mmHg) is often recommended to alleviate mild swelling and discomfort. However, if you have more severe symptoms or a medical condition, you may need a higher level of compression. Always consult with your healthcare provider to determine the best compression level for your needs.
MaterialThe material of the compression socks affects their comfort, breathability, and durability. Common materials include nylon, spandex, and cotton blends. Nylon and spandex provide good elasticity and durability, while cotton blends offer more breathability and comfort. For pregnant women, it's important to choose a material that is comfortable to wear for extended periods and allows your skin to breathe. If you have sensitive skin, look for socks with a higher cotton content or those labeled as hypoallergenic.
Size and FitProper sizing is crucial for compression socks to work effectively. Compression socks come in various sizes, and it's important to measure your legs to find the right fit. Key measurements include the circumference of your ankle, calf, and sometimes thigh, as well as the length from your heel to the top of the sock. A well-fitting sock should provide consistent compression without being too tight or too loose. Many brands offer sizing charts to help you find the right size based on your measurements. If you're in between sizes, it's usually better to go with the larger size to avoid excessive tightness.
LengthCompression socks come in different lengths, including knee-high, thigh-high, and full-length (pantyhose). The length you choose depends on where you need the most support. Knee-high socks are the most common and are suitable for general swelling and discomfort in the lower legs. Thigh-high and full-length options provide additional support for the upper legs and may be recommended if you have varicose veins or swelling that extends above the knee. Consider your specific needs and consult with your healthcare provider to determine the best length for you.
Ease of UsePutting on and taking off compression socks can be challenging, especially during pregnancy. Look for socks with features that make them easier to use, such as a wide top band, a zipper, or a donning aid. Some socks are designed with a graduated compression pattern, which means they are tighter at the ankle and gradually loosen up the leg, making them easier to put on. Consider your dexterity and mobility when choosing a pair, and opt for socks that you can comfortably manage on your own.
